What an Analyst, SMB Program Delivery, North America Social Impact & Sustainability does at Visa?
The Analyst, SMB Program Delivery will play a critical part in ensuring the successful execution and delivery of small business programs and events. The role will work closely with internal teams and external partners to coordinate deliverables, track progress, and ensure timelines are met. This position is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, can juggle multiple priorities, and is eager to learn and grow in a client-facing role.

U.S. APPLICANTS ONLY: The estimated salary range for a new hire into this position is 93,200.00 to 131,850.00 USD per year, which may include potential sales incentive payments (if applicable). Salary may vary depending on job-related factors which may include knowledge, skills, experience, and location. In addition, this position may be eligible for bonus and equity. Visa has a comprehensive benefits package for which this position may be eligible that includes Medical, Dental, Vision, 401 (k), FSA/HSA, Life Insurance, Paid Time Off, and Wellness Program.
